Job Summary:In this role you will perform complex structural engineering tasks to produce design and estimates for projects within the Manufacturing and Technology Business Unit. You will develop, evaluate, or modify design, drawings, specifications and requisitions for foundations, concrete and structural steel superstructure and associated components and and other structural works under the supervision of a senior Engineer or Engineering Group Supervisor.

Major Responsibilities:Schedules, conducts, or coordinates detailed phases of the civil/structural engineering work for a global business unit, a project or staff group to include the preparation of original designs layouts, details, drawings and specifications for structures, building, etc.
Participates in the design, development and modification of Civil/Structural components and processes utilizing relevant Engineering Department Procedures(EDPs), design standards and guides, Bechtel Standard Application Programs (BSAPs) and Design Control Check List (DCCL) and Design Review Notices(DRNs)
Designs structures using knowledge of structural analysis, including statics, dynamics, and materials engineering
Determines the appropriate use of various structural elements such as steel, wood, masonry, and concrete to ensure appropriate material is used based on load or stress requirements
Originates and checks structural engineering deliverables, such as steel and concrete calculations, specifications, and material requisitions
Analyzes problems with conflicting design requirements, sketches ideas and possible solutions
Analyzes and reports on the suitability of unconventional materials, techniques and/or difficult coordination requirements
Assists in the preparation of cost estimates, quantity take-offs for proposals, forecasts, and change orders
Completes Civil/Structural documentation and procedures for installation and maintenance
Provides assistance toproject and construction management in identifying and complying with project Civil/Structural requirements and in addressing issues as they arise during project execution
